Let's Cook

  1. Step 1.

    In a small bowl, mix together 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on, 1 teaspoon ground ginger, and a pinch of ground cloves until combined.

  2. Step 2.

    Prepare 1 batch of your chosen cake dough as directed, but replace the nutmeg specified in the recipe with the spice mixture you just made, and replace the superfine sugar with ⅓ cup brown sugar. Add 2 tablespoons molasses along with the vanilla extract called for in the dough recipe.

  3. Step 3.

    Fry or bake the doughnuts according to the original dough recipe's instructions. For traditional doughnuts, shape and fry or bake as directed; for drop doughnuts, drop spoonfuls of dough into hot oil or onto a baking sheet.

  4. Step 4.

    After the doughnuts have cooled slightly, glaze them with 1 batch of Ginger glaze. If desired, sprinkle with 2 tablespoons crystallized ginger chips while the glaze is still wet.
